Central Warning Unit
To increase driving and operational safety an
automatic warning system has been deve-
loped that shows the driver, via the unmistake-
able warning light that comes on in the instru-
ment panel, that there is a possible malfunc-
tion. This is done automatically without the
driver having to do anything.
The warning lights for the various functions
are located in the Combi instruments.

Should a malfunction occur the central warn-
ing light in the instrument console will come
on. At the same time the light for the individual
function will also come on, indicating what is
malfunctioning.
The function control is divided into two priority
groups. Functions that are essential for
driving and operational safety have prio-
rity 1 - the central warning light flashes to-
gether with the individual warning light.
The following functions have priority 1:
Brake fluid level, Oil pressure, Oil level.
If a malfunction is indicated here the vehicle
must be stopped and turned off immediately.
The fault must be rectified.
Functions that do not require immediate
attention have priority 2 - the central and
individual warning lights come on conti-
nuously.
The following functions have priority 2:
ABS (Anti-lock) brake system, Brake pad
wear, Handbrake, Cooling fluid level, Cooling
fluid temperature, Fuel tank reserve, Screen
washer water level, Brake lights, Tail lights,
Toothed belt tension.
These functions show the need for part re-
placement, re-filling, retensioning the toothed
belt, change of driving mode or release of the
handbrake, but not for an immediate halting
of the journey or visit to a garage.
